Is science the only way to understand the world and are genes us?Renowned moral philosopher Mary Midgley tackles these pressing questions andmore in her powerful new book. She asks how can we bring together thedepersonalized picture of ourselves which we draw from science with thepersonal attitudes by which we live how can we harmonize science and poetry?With her customary clear style and sharp prose Midgley points out that thefields of science and poetry are not really hostile kingdoms. They areinstead parts of our wider worldview snapshots taken from differentangles. It is because we hold them apart that we go wrong on a host ofproblems from the relation between mind and body to global warming and thedebate about memes.Invoking the unity of the imagination to restore the wholeness of our livesScience and Poetry is a tour de force of passionate but clearheaded thinkingabout science and ourselves. «
